Home Water Filtration in Denver, CO
Home water filtration services involve installing or upgrading systems designed to improve the quality of drinking water throughout a property. These services typically cover projects such as installing whole-house filtration units, under-sink filters, or point-of-use systems to reduce contaminants like chlorine, sediment, and other impurities. Property owners often seek information about the types of filtration options available, how these systems can enhance water taste and safety, and what maintenance might be required to keep the system functioning effectively.
Before requesting home water filtration services, property owners usually want to understand the specific issues with their water supply, such as unusual odors, discoloration, or mineral content. They may also inquire about the compatibility of filtration systems with existing plumbing, the expected lifespan of different filter types, and the benefits of various technologies like carbon filters or reverse osmosis. Gathering this information helps ensure that the chosen system meets the household’s needs and provides reliable, clean water for daily use.

Common Home Water Filtration Jobs
Whole house filtration systems - improve water quality throughout the entire property for better taste and clarity.
Under-sink filters - provide filtered drinking water directly at the kitchen faucet for convenience.
Reverse osmosis units - remove contaminants to deliver pure, clean water for drinking and cooking.
Water softening solutions - reduce mineral buildup and prevent scale in appliances and plumbing fixtures.
Point-of-use filters - target specific appliances or fixtures to enhance water quality where it’s needed most.
Maintenance and replacement services - ensure filtration systems operate effectively with regular upkeep.
Home Water Filtration Questions
What types of water filtration systems are available? There are various options including point-of-use filters, whole-house systems, and reverse osmosis units to improve water quality throughout a property.
How do I know if a water filtration system is needed? Signs include unusual tastes or odors, visible particles, or mineral buildup in fixtures, indicating water quality issues.
What are the benefits of installing a water filtration system? Proper filtration can enhance water taste, reduce contaminants, and protect plumbing and appliances from mineral buildup.
What maintenance is required for water filtration systems? Regular filter replacements and system checks ensure optimal performance and water quality over time.
